Teams often seek alternatives because Qwilr focuses on interactive documents rather than end-to-end signature workflows, leaving gaps in bulk sending, advanced authentication, and native mobile signing for high-volume or regulated tech environments.
signNow positions itself as a secure, compliance-focused eSignature platform with broader enterprise features and stronger mobile support than Qwilr.
Early-stage technology sales teams need rapid proposal turnaround with payment collection and lightweight integrations. They benefit from Qwilr's interactive proposal layouts but may switch to signNow or PandaDoc when they require bulk sending and stronger automation for recurring quotes.
Enterprise technology organizations require strict compliance, SSO, audit trails, and large-scale bulk sending. SignNow's HIPAA assistance, SOC2 controls, and SSO/SAML capabilities typically align better with enterprise procurement and security requirements than Qwilr.

Electronic signatures generated via Qwilr can contribute to enforceable agreements when backed by adequate audit trails and signer intent documentation.
For high-assurance legal scenarios—such as HIPAA, CFR Part 11, or international qualified eID workflows—organizations should evaluate providers with explicit certifications and dedicated compliance controls beyond Qwilr's baseline audit capabilities.
